Transaction

7e77aaaf0eda1a7a3618d3f7019080733bddbcc00a8620a6fc963a3b33c2ac99
303,657 confirmations
Timestamp
1592937755
Block636,032
Fee7,168 sats
Fee rate37.3 sats/vB
view on mempool.space

Inputs & Outputs